SHERMAN, Tex. -- A new energy plant will soon be in Sherman. The city council approved the move at Monday night's meeting.

Panda Energy will be building a 500-megawatt power plant on Howe Road west of the Tyson plant. The Dallas-based company will build a natural gas facility that will be one of the cleanest burning plants in the state.

The project will also bring several dozen high-paying jobs to the area.

Company representatives say it will be a North Texas project, from start to finish.

"It’s Texas, homegrown-type, natural gas. We got some of our employees actually living here in Sherman. In fact, the project manager of this project will be able to run the project from his house here in Sherman, Texas," Ralph Killian of Panda Energy says.

Panda Energy hopes to break ground sometime next summer.
